Mini Biography

Emily Wagner was born and raised in New York City's Upper West Side. She began her acting career at age 6 as the youngest member of the theatrical troupe The Merry Mini Players. She starred in the cult 80s NBC/PBS series High Feather.

By the time she arrived at Vassar, she had put acting on the back burner in order to focus on a rigorous education. She graduated from Vassar with a BFA degree in Art History and Fine Art. It was there that she also grew serious about creative writing and began to write short stories and plays. Post college, Emily returned to NYC to study acting with Susan Batson, then moved to Los Angeles where she has played paramedic Doris Pickman on ER since the show's second episode.

Emily co-created, wrote, produced and starred in several short and feature films, some with her brother Andrew (Counting, South Main), some with her longtime collaborator Julie Delpy (Blah, Blah, Blah) and some with both of them Looking for Jimmy (2002) and Careful, all of which went on to have impressive festival runs. She is also an artist and shows with the Acuna-Hansen gallery in LA's Chinatown.



Trivia

She attended the 2005 Sundance Film Festival with the film The Talent Given Us (2004), directed by her brother Andrew Wagner, in which she and sister Maggie Wagner star.

Served as a panelist on a digital filmmaking symposium at the AFI FEST 2000 where Looking for Jimmy (2002) premiered. She starred in and co-created this film directed by her longtime friend, actress/director/screenwriter Julie Delpy, and her brother, director Andrew Wagner.

She is an accomplished artist and shows with the Acuna-Hansen Gallery in Chinatown, LA and Mixture Comtemporary Art in Houston, Texas.

Emily has written, produced and starred in three short films which have gone to many prominent festivals, including Sundance, Telluride, Toronto and many more.

Starred in the Julie Delpy-directed short film Blah Blah Blah (1995), which she and Delpy co-wrote and took to the Sundance Film Festival in 2005.

She is also a DJ and loves 70s and 80s funk, soul and disco classics of which she has a huge record collection.

Niece of director Mark Rydell.

Daughter was born April 8, 2006.

Stars in Motherhoodlum, a verite-style comedy series on youtube (www.youtube.com/emwags) that she co-created with Chelsea Gilmore, producer of The Talent Given Us. The show takes an irreverent, hilarious and unapologetic look at the perilous world of new parenthood. It's a Curb Your Enthusiasm for the stroller set!.

Emily attended the Sundance Film Festival is 2008, starring in the film Chronic Town.
